Extra bending parameters can be found on this page, which displays parameters related to
the part, and depending on the VisiTouch configuration and the type of action performed,
also displays various settings for the current bend. Most of these parameters can also be
found in the Quick access tab.
Material
This is not a sequence parameter, but of course a part parameter.
Each touch on the material’s name selects the next available from
the list of Materials.
Material thickness
The default thickness, defined in Materials, is automatically
displayed when changing material. It is however possible to change
it simply by touching this icon.
If on the other hand, the parameter
Predefined thickn. is set to yes, a touch on
this icon will open a numerical pad as show to
the right, where the operator will be able to
select directly one of the predefined
thicknesses.
This is a part parameter.
Material sigma
The default sigma, defined in Materials, is automatically displayed
when changing material. It is however possible to change it simply
by touching this icon. This is also of course a part parameter.
Back gauge retractation
The back-gauge retraction can be activated/deactivated at its
Default retraction value using this icon. It is possible to modify the
value by touching it. This is a sequence parameter, meaning it can
be modified with each step of the program.
Speed change threshold and bending speed
The distance parameter allows the operator to increase the height
of the speed change point. The speed parameter allows decreasing
the bending speed from its maximum value defined in the machine
parameters.
Bending length / Position offset
This parameter defines the width of the sheet metal part that
will be pinched between the tools. It is used to calculate the
bending force.
If this parameter is not activated (grey), the VisiTouch will not calculate the bending Force
and the Crowning.
This parameter defines the position of the sheet metal in the machine.
